I think the problem isn't PS3 hardware, but rather, how the game would look onscreen. The game makes heavy use of several on screen gauges (tach, speed, time, advantage/disadvantage, map, opponent name) as well as the rear view mirror. I think allowing splitscreen in an ID game would make my eyes hurt, having either scrunched down versions of the above-mentioned HUD items or downright excluding some of them (I can easily see the rear view mirror being booted from splitscreen modes).

The PS2 and PS3 can handle splitscreen just fine. The game, however, just doesn't seem suited for splitscreen play.
